Preschool Ocean Crafts
Paper bag jellyfish craft – this is one of my all-time favorite preschool crafts. It works on so many skills all at once. Don’t miss the video at the end of this post, it’s me making this craft and doing other activities that are perfect resources for an ocean unit study.
Glittery Shells, why not make something pretty even better with some glitter. You can find earth-friendly glitter here.
X-ray Fish are so simple to make. This is one of my favorite fish crafts. Have your child or students cut the bones from larger pieces of paper to work on scissor skills. If you teach Prek or kindergarten this is a great x-themed craft to try!
Paper plate crab this silly little craft is a fun one to make after flipping over rocks at the beach to see crabs in real life!
Washi Tape Starfish – Kids LOVE tape. They do, and it’s an excellent tool to use for fine motor development.
Puffy Paint Fish – make your own puffy paint and create this messy but fun preschool ocean craft.
Sandpaper Sandcastle – this is a fun way to work on how shapes can work together, and it’s also a great road trip activity!
Painting Shells is a classic, and it’s simple. Perfect for busy days after collecting seashells on the beach!
Cupcake liner jellyfish is a fun way to use up those last few cupcake liners without making cupcakes!
Paper Roll Fish – Use up those tp rolls and make this sparkly amazing fish!
Sea Urchin Craft – Work on fine motor skills and much more with this fun and spiky ocean craft.
Shell Picture Frame What a fun way to remember something you did this summer. If you don’t live near a beach, you can get shells at your local dollar store for this beach craft.
Playdough Ocean Animals – work on creativity and fine motor skills with this fun ocean craft idea.
Starfish Craft – use bubble wrap to make fun prints. You can also cut the paper into other shapes like whales, seahorses, or mermaid tales!
